Time limits in SNAP harm women, LGBTQIA+ people, and their families. Taking away nutrition assistance will not help women and LGBTQIA+ people find jobs any faster; it will just increase hunger. As a nation, we should fight hunger by helping families struggling to make ends meet put food on the table. Congress should increase SNAP benefits so fewer families have to choose between food and shelter or other necessities and reduce inequities in SNAP that prevent many women, LGBTQIA+ people, and their families from accessing this critical program. SNAP needs to be protected and strengthened.
